// Example 2.2: Change in diode voltage clc, clear T=300; // Operating temperature in kelvins VT=T/11600; // Voltage equivalent to temperatue at room temperature in volts ID1=1; // Let the initial diode current be 1 A ID2=10*ID1; // Final diode current eta=1; // for Ge deltaVD=eta*VT*log(ID2/ID1); // Change in diode voltage in volts deltaVD=deltaVD*1e3; // Change in diode voltage in milivolts disp(deltaVD,"Change in diode voltage (for Ge) (mV) = "); eta=2; // for Si deltaVD=eta*VT*log(ID2/ID1); // Change in diode voltage in volts deltaVD=deltaVD*1e3; // Change in diode voltage in milivolts disp(deltaVD,"Change in diode voltage (for Si) (mV) = ");
